
Tesla intends to complete its Cybertruck electric ute (pickup truck) development this year for production in 2023.
During a ceremony launching the start of Model Y deliveries at Gigafactory Berlin, Musk was reportedly asked by an employee about Tesla’s short-term goals. “We want to complete the development of Cybertruck this year and be ready for production next year,” Musk added.
Tesla first revealed the Cybertruck in 2019 but production was delayed with later reports suggesting an end of 2022 start at Gigafactory Texas.
During Tesla’s last earnings report in January, Musk said Tesla wouldn’t launch any new vehicle in 2022 but indicated the Cybertruck, more Semi trucks, and a new Roadster would come in 2023.
